SCFD Rex Morgan Award

Thanks to the SCFD Board, its hardworking staff and all those who were able to attend the Dec. 1 Rex Morgan Award. I was greatly honored by the kind words of friends and supporters of the SCFD.

Attached are my prepared remarks. My theme was that a modest and innovative funding mechanics blossomed into one of the most unique and envied citizen-directed, local government organizations in the country. Its success is partially a reflection for the growth of public and urban leaders’ realization that cultural infrastructure is as important to quality of life and the economy as many brick and mortar projects. The District’s 22 years of performance is also a product of a host of good public policies and good politics embedded in the statute and implemented by successive boards and cultural stakeholders.

As you know, the SCFD has significantly contributed to making Denver a special city in a culturally enriched region. This award is a tribute to all who helped found, preserve and extend this District.
